Title :
Sensing strains and stresses through dielectrostriction response

Abstract :
Strains in a loaded material can be monitored through its dielectrostriction response. Dielectrostriction is defined as variation of material´s dielectric properties with deformation. A planar interdigitated sensor measuring dielectrostriction response is capable monitoring deformation of a material without mechanical contact. Present study confirms linearity of the dielectrostriction response with strains. Demonstrated four capacitor sensor rosette is capable to measure both principal direction and difference in principal strains of a plane loaded specimen
